Tree removal services involve the careful cutting and disposal of trees that are no longer suitable for a property or pose potential risks. This process typically includes assessing the tree’s health and stability, safely trimming or dismantling the tree, and removing all debris from the site. Professional contractors use specialized equipment and techniques to ensure the job is done efficiently and safely, minimizing any impact on the surrounding landscape. Tree removal is often necessary when a tree is dead, diseased, or damaged, making it a priority to prevent potential hazards such as falling branches or toppling trees.
These services help address a variety of problems that can threaten the safety and appearance of a property. Overgrown or unstable trees can block sunlight, damage structures, or obstruct views. Diseased or dying trees may become weak and more likely to fall during storms or high winds. Additionally, trees that are too close to power lines, buildings, or driveways can create safety concerns or interfere with property development. Removing problematic trees can improve the safety, accessibility, and aesthetic appeal of residential or commercial properties.

The overview below groups typical Tree Removal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lithonia, GA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Tree Removals - Most local contractors charge between $250 and $600 for routine tree removal jobs involving small to medium-sized trees. Many projects fall within this range, especially for trees under 30 feet tall. Larger or more complex removals can exceed this, but they are less common.
Medium-Sized Tree Removal - Removing trees between 30 and 60 feet typically costs between $600 and $1,500. These jobs are common in residential areas around Lithonia, with costs increasing based on tree size and location.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this range for particularly challenging sites.
Larger or Hazardous Tree Removal - Trees over 60 feet or those in difficult locations can cost $1,500 to $3,000 or more. Such projects are less frequent but often necessary for safety or property concerns, especially with mature or leaning trees requiring specialized equipment.
Full Tree Removal and Stump Grinding - Complete removal, including stump grinding, generally ranges from $1,000 to $4,000 depending on tree size and site conditions. Larger, more complex projects can go beyond this range, but many jobs are completed within the middle tiers for typical residential properties.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What should I consider before removing a tree? It's important to evaluate the tree's size, location, and health to determine if removal is necessary. Consulting with local contractors can help assess potential impacts on your property and identify the best approach.
Are there any permits required for tree removal in Lithonia, GA? Permit requirements vary depending on local regulations and the property's zoning. A professional service provider can help determine if permits are needed for your specific situation.
How do I know if a tree is safe to keep or needs to be removed? Signs such as dead branches, leaning, or root damage may indicate a tree's health is compromised. Local contractors can evaluate the tree's condition and advise on whether removal is advisable.
What methods do contractors use to remove trees safely? Tree removal typically involves specialized equipment and techniques to ensure safety and minimize property damage. Experienced service providers follow industry best practices for safe removal.
Can tree removal affect nearby structures or utilities? Yes, removal can impact nearby buildings, power lines, or underground utilities if not properly managed. Consulting with local experts can help prevent potential issues during the removal process.
